The hotel is strategically located near the city center which allows you to walk to most of the areas of interest in Baguio. But if one needs to go to specific locations, cabs are easy to flag down. It's a relatively new hotel which serves its purpose as a place to stay comfortably especially on business where you can hold meetings in the lobby. The furnishings in the room lack a table and chair if one wants to work and the internet may struggle when the hotel is fully occupied but is satisfactory for basic communications such as messaging or email. Overall, it was bang for the buck and met my needs during my week long stay on business.

The Location of the hotel is good there are many restaurants nearby as well as convenience stores gasoline station banks drugstore,. Around 5-10 minutes walk from Burnham Park. If you will take the taxi the cost is around 40-50 pesos depending on the traffic. They have a restaurant and Gerry's Grill is just outside. The reception is very helpful the rooms are basic. They provide a water dispenser near the elevator on each floor. The room is so basic, plus factor that they have airconditioned rooms because even if its Baguio at noon time the weather is warm. The only downside is they dont have cabinets in the room nor a big table where you can place your things .

Frequently Asked Questions about Travelite Hotel
Which popular attractions are close to Travelite Hotel?
Nearby attractions include Burnham Park (0.4 km), Our Lady of Lordes Parish (0.3 km), and Redzel's Baguio - Home of Ube Halaya and Strawberry Preserves (0.02 km).
What are some of the property amenities at Travelite Hotel?
Some of the more popular amenities offered include free wifi, an on-site restaurant, and a lounge.
What food & drink options are available at Travelite Hotel?
Guests can enjoy an on-site restaurant and a lounge during their stay.
What are some restaurants close to Travelite Hotel?
Conveniently located restaurants include Chaya, Canto Bogchi Joint, and Lamisaan Dining & Bar.
Which languages are spoken by the staff at Travelite Hotel?
The staff speaks multiple languages, including English and Filipino.
Are there any historical sites close to Travelite Hotel?
Many travellers enjoy visiting Tam-Awan Village (2.1 km) and The Mansion (3.2 km).
